Senior Property Manager (Affordable Housing)

Location: Roxbury, MA

Salary: $110,000–$115,000 annually

Schedule: Full-Time

Work Environment: Central Office-Based with Oversight of Two Properties


Lead with Impact. Grow with Opportunity.

We are seeking an experienced and driven Senior Property Manager to join our growing team in the Roxbury area. This is an exceptional opportunity for a property management professional who is passionate about affordable housing, operational excellence, and team leadership.

In this role, you will oversee the operations of two affordable housing communities totaling fewer than 200 units, while directly managing and mentoring three Property Managers. Based out of the central office, you will play a key leadership role in ensuring regulatory compliance, financial performance, resident satisfaction, and team success.

Key Responsibilities

Operations & Property Oversight

  • Oversee the daily operations and performance of two affordable housing communities.
  • Ensure properties are maintained to the highest standards of safety, appearance, and resident satisfaction.
  • Monitor occupancy, leasing activity, resident retention, and operational efficiency.
  • Collaborate with maintenance and site teams to ensure timely resolution of property-related issues.
  • Conduct regular property inspections and audits.

Affordable Housing Compliance

  • Ensure compliance with all affordable housing regulations and program requirements.
  • Oversee and review annual and interim recertifications.
  • Maintain compliance with LIHTC, HUD, Section 8, and other affordable housing programs as applicable.
  • Prepare for and manage agency audits, inspections, and reporting requirements.
  • Train and support site teams on compliance procedures and best practices.

Leadership & Team Development

  • Directly supervise and mentor three Property Managers.
  • Provide coaching, performance management, and professional development support.
  • Foster a collaborative, customer-focused culture across the portfolio.
  • Assist with recruiting, training, and onboarding new team members as needed.

Financial Management

  • Partner with leadership to develop and manage property budgets.
  • Monitor financial performance, including revenue, expenses, occupancy, and collections.
  • Review monthly financial reports and implement strategies to achieve ownership goals.
  • Identify opportunities for operational improvements and cost savings.

Qualifications

Required

  • 5+ years of property management experience.
  • Previous experience managing affordable housing communities.
  • Extensive experience with affordable housing compliance and recertifications.
  • Experience supervising onsite staff and property management teams.
  • Strong understanding of property operations, budgeting, and resident relations.
  • Excellent communication, organizational, and leadership skills.
  • Proficiency with property management software and Microsoft Office.

Preferred

  • Experience overseeing multiple properties.
  • LIHTC, HUD, Section 8, or other affordable housing program experience.
  • COS, HCCP, TCS, or related affordable housing certifications.
  • Bachelor's degree in Business, Real Estate, Property Management, or a related field.
